Names That Mean Success Across Cultures

In different parts of the world, parents have chosen names that signify success to inspire and motivate their children. These names not only reflect parents’ dreams for their children but also serve as a constant reminder to work hard and maintain a positive outlook. Let’s explore names from various cultures and their meanings related to success.

Indian Names:

In Indian culture, names that symbolize success are deeply rooted in ancient traditions and beliefs. For example, the name “Ariyaan” means “one who is noble and victorious” in Sanskrit. Another popular choice is “Dhanya,” which represents “blessed and successful” qualities. These names carry a sense of pride and honor, reflecting the importance of success in Indian society.

Vedic Names:

Vedic names, derived from the ancient Indian scriptures, also hold significance in terms of success. “Yash” is a popular Vedic name that means “glory and victory.” It represents the belief that success comes from embracing one’s true potential and making a positive impact on the world. Similarly, “Vibhu” symbolizes being powerful, successful, and all-encompassing.

Arabic Names:

In Arabic culture, names associated with success often carry a sense of strength and accomplishment. For instance, the name “Nasir” means “helper and victorious,” emphasizing the importance of supporting others on the path to success. “Amir” is another common name, which signifies “leader and prince,” reflecting qualities of ambition and leadership.

Success-Related Names from Different Origins

Names that symbolize success are not bound by any particular culture or origin. They transcend borders and languages, embodying the universal concept of achievement and triumph. Here, we explore success-related names from various origins, showcasing the rich diversity and meanings associated with these names.

Indian Names

In Indian culture, names meaning success are deeply rooted and carry significant symbolism. For instance, the name “Aarav” translates to “peaceful,” signifying the attainment of inner harmony and success in life. Another popular name is “Lakshmi,” which represents not just material wealth but also spiritual prosperity and abundance.

Arabic Names

In Arabic culture, names that symbolize success often reflect attributes such as strength, honor, and victory. The name “Aziz” encapsulates the essence of success, representing someone who is highly esteemed and respected. Similarly, the name “Najwa” signifies the ability to make wise decisions and achieve success through careful thought and consideration.

Japanese Names

Japanese names associated with success often embody qualities such as perseverance, determination, and resilience. The name “Takeshi” means “warrior” and represents someone who overcomes challenges and achieves victory. Another name, “Ayaka,” signifies a bright and colorful future, representing the success and prosperity that lies ahead.

African Names

African names that symbolize success are deeply rooted in cultural traditions and beliefs. The name “Zuri” means “beautiful” in Swahili and represents the success and beauty that can be found in all aspects of life. Similarly, the name “Amani” signifies peace, harmony, and the achievement of success through unity and cooperation.
